- The distance between Basel, Switzerland and Östersund, Sweden is approximately 1,792 km or 1,113 mi.
- To reach Basel in this distance one would set out from Östersund bearing 197.4° or SS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Basel bearing 191.5° or SSW .
- Basel has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Östersund has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Basel is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Östersund is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 6.9 °C (12.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.9 °C (7°F) less in Basel.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 221 mm (8.7 in) more which is equivalent to 221 l/m² (5.42 US gal/ft²) or 2,210,000 l/ha (236,264 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/5 as much.
- There are 112 more hours of sunlight per year in Basel. In whichever way circa 0h 18' more per day or about 1 as many.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.6° higher in Basel than in Östersund.
- Relative humidity levels are 1.9%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 6.3°C (11.4°F) higher.
